Staff/Principal Software Engineer - Continuous Integration Infrastructure

Block United State
Remote
This Job is No Longer Active This position is no longer accepting applications
AI Summary

Join Block's CII team as a Staff/Principal Software Engineer to design, build, and operate scalable CI services. Collaborate with cross-functional teams to enhance developer experience, operational efficiency, and security.

Key Highlights
Lead the design, development, and operation of scalable CI and artifact storage systems
Mentor and support fellow engineers to grow technical capabilities and best practices
Champion security best practices, focusing on supply chain security and system integrity
Technical Skills Required
Go Kotlin Java Ruby Python Bash/shell scripting AWS Container technologies
Benefits & Perks
Remote work flexibility
Comprehensive medical, dental, and vision insurance plans
Flexible time off policies
Retirement savings plans with company matching contributions
Support for modern family planning and parental leave
Access to professional development resources and continuous learning opportunities

Job Description


About The Company

Block is a pioneering technology company dedicated to increasing access to the global economy through innovative financial and technological solutions. Built from many blocks, our organization fosters a culture of inclusivity, collaboration, and continuous innovation. Our foundational teams—spanning People, Finance, Counsel, Hardware, Information Security, Platform Infrastructure Engineering, and more—work tirelessly across disciplines and geographies to develop supportive policies, secure systems, and cutting-edge initiatives. We believe that diverse perspectives drive innovation and create growth opportunities. At Block, every challenge is an opportunity to empower individuals and businesses worldwide, making economic participation accessible and equitable for all.

About The Role

We are seeking a highly experienced Staff/Principal Software Engineer to join our Continuous Integration Infrastructure (CII) team. This team is responsible for developing and maintaining the underlying infrastructure that supports our expansive CI and artifact systems, which are critical to thousands of engineers across Block. The role involves designing, building, and operating scalable and reliable CI services that streamline developer workflows, improve release quality, and enhance software delivery security and observability. As a key member of our engineering team, you will collaborate closely with cross-functional teams, define strategic roadmaps, and lead initiatives to unify and optimize our CI infrastructure. Your work will directly impact developer experience, operational efficiency, and the security posture of our software delivery pipelines.

Qualifications

  • Multiple years of experience at Staff or Principal level, demonstrating impact across multiple teams and projects
  • Extensive experience architecting and operating large-scale CI or build systems in production environments
  • Deep understanding of container technologies and related infrastructure
  • Strong expertise in designing and implementing secure systems, with a focus on supply chain security
  • Proficiency in software engineering languages such as Go, Kotlin, Java, Ruby, or Python, and Bash/shell scripting
  • Experience with automation, capacity planning, and resource optimization within cloud environments, particularly AWS
  • Excellent problem-solving skills with a natural curiosity for learning new technologies and building high-quality software
  • Exceptional collaboration and mentoring abilities, with a proven track record of leading technical initiatives

Responsibilities

  • Partner with engineering teams to define and execute the strategic roadmap for CI infrastructure
  • Lead the design, development, and operation of scalable CI and artifact storage systems
  • Own end-to-end responsibility for CI services, including performance, security, and reliability enhancements
  • Mentor and support fellow engineers to grow technical capabilities and best practices
  • Develop automation solutions for dynamic capacity planning and resource management to optimize performance and cost
  • Consolidate multiple CI platforms into a unified, standardized experience for end-users
  • Provide technical guidance and solutions across teams such as Developer Experience, Platform Engineering, and Security
  • Champion security best practices, focusing on supply chain security and system integrity
  • Stay current with emerging technologies and industry trends to continually improve infrastructure and workflows

Benefits

  • Remote work flexibility, allowing you to work from anywhere within the designated time zones
  • Comprehensive medical, dental, and vision insurance plans
  • Flexible time off policies to promote work-life balance
  • Retirement savings plans with company matching contributions
  • Support for modern family planning and parental leave
  • Access to professional development resources and continuous learning opportunities
  • Inclusive and collaborative company culture that values diversity and innovation

Equal Opportunity

Block is an equal opportunity employer. We celebrate diversity and are committed to creating an inclusive environment for all employees. We do not discriminate based on race, color, religion, gender, gender identity or expression, sexual orientation, national origin, genetics, disability, age, or veteran status. We believe that diverse perspectives foster innovation and drive our mission forward.


Similar Jobs

Explore other opportunities that match your interests

Visa Sponsorship Relocation Remote
Job Type Full-time
Experience Level Not Applicable

Jobot

United State
Visa Sponsorship Relocation Remote
Job Type Full-time
Experience Level Mid-Senior level

executive rhythm, llc

United State

Electrical Design Engineer

Programming
8h ago
Visa Sponsorship Relocation Remote
Job Type Full-time
Experience Level Not Applicable

Lensa

United State

Subscribe our newsletter

New Things Will Always Update Regularly